SENATE BILL NO. 13
BY SENATOR B. GAUTREAUX 
RETIREMENT BENEFITS. Allows garnishment of Louisiana public retirement or pension
system, plan, or fund benefits of an elected official to pay fines or restitution imposed for
a felony associated with his office. (7/1/10)

A. Notwithstanding any other provision of law to the contrary, any1
retirement allowance, benefit, or refund of accumulated contributions paid to any2
member, former member, or retiree under the provisions of any public retirement3
system, or the portion of a retirement allowance, benefit, or refund of accumulated4
contributions paid to a spouse or former spouse under the provisions of R.S. 11:291,5
shall be subject to garnishment or court-ordered assignment to pay child support.6
B.(1)  Notwithstanding any other provision of law to the contrary, any7
pension, retirement allowance, or benefit, or any refund of accumulated8
contributions payable to any member, former member, or retiree under the9
provisions of any public pension or retirement system, plan, or fund shall be10
subject to garnishment under a writ of fieri facias to pay any court-ordered11
restitution or fine imposed on such member, former member, or retiree as a12
result of a conviction of or a plea of guilty or nolo contendere to the commission13
of a felony for misconduct associated with such person's service as an elected14
official for which credit in the system, plan, or fund was earned or accrued.15
(2) Notwithstanding any other provision of law to the contrary, a16
garnishment authorized pursuant to this Subsection may be continuing in17
nature as necessary to pay the court-ordered restitution or fine in full.18

DIGEST
B. Gautreaux (SB 13)
Present law (R.S. 13:3881(A) and R.S. 20:33) provides for a general exemption from seizure
under any writ, mandate, or process whatsoever for certain income or property of a debtor.
Specifies that, except as provided in present law, the following shall be exempt from all

Proposed law retains present law. Provides that the pension or retirement benefit of an
elected official may be garnished or seized to pay any fine or restitution imposed as a penalty
for conviction of a felony associated with his office.
Present law (R.S. 11:291) provides for protection of a spouse's community property interest
in the public retirement or pension benefit of a member or retiree of a state or statewide
retirement system.
The state public retirement systems are:
(1)The Louisiana State Employees' Retirement System (LASERS);
(2)The Teachers' Retirement System of Louisiana (Teachers');
(3)The Louisiana School Employees' Retirement System (LSERS); and
(4)The State Police Pension and Retirement System (SPPRS).
The statewide public retirement systems are:
(1)The Assessors' Retirement Fund (LARF);
(2)The Clerks of Court Retirement and Relief Fund (Clerks);
(3)The District Attorneys' Retirement System (DARS);
(4)The Firefighters' Retirement System (FRS);
(5)The Municipal Employees' Retirement System of Louisiana (MERS);
(6)The Municipal Police Employees' Retirement System (MPERS);
(7)The Parochial Employees' Retirement System of Louisiana (PERS);
(8)The Registrars of Voters Employees' Retirement System (ROVERS); and
(9)The Sheriffs' Pension and Relief Fund (Sheriffs').
Proposed law retains present law.
Present law (R.S. 11:292) provides that notwithstanding any other provision of present law
to the contrary, any retirement allowance, benefit, or refund of accumulated contributions
paid to any member, former member, or retiree under the provisions of any public retirement
system, or the portion of a retirement allowance, benefit, or refund of accumulated
contributions paid to a spouse or former spouse under the provisions of present law (R.S.
11:291) shall be subject to garnishment or court-ordered assignment to pay child support.
Proposed law retains present law. SB NO. 13

Various provisions of present law specific to particular public retirement or pension systems,
plans, or funds provide that any annuity, retirement allowance or benefit, or refund of
contributions, or any optional benefit or any other benefit paid or payable to any person
under the provisions of present law is exempt from any state or municipal tax and is exempt
from levy and sale, garnishment, attachment, or any other process whatsoever, and is
unassignable.
Proposed law retains present law.
Some provisions of present law regarding such exemptions specify that garnishment or
assignment pursuant to present law (R.S. 11:292) is an exception to the provisions
exempting retirement or pension benefits from execution.  Provide that benefits may be
garnished or assigned pursuant to present law.
Proposed law retains present law. These provisions apply to LASERS, Teachers', LSERS,
SPPRS, LARF, Clerks, DARS, MERS, the Employees' Retirement System of the city of
Baton Rouge and the parish of East Baton Rouge, the Employees' Retirement System of the
city of Shreveport, ROVERS, Sheriffs', MPERS, FRS, the Firemen's Pension and Relief
Fund for the City of Bossier City, and the Policemen's Pension and Relief Fund for the city
of Bossier City.
Other provisions of present law exempting retirement or pension benefits from garnishment
or execution do not contain a specific reference to the exception for seizure for child support
in present law (R.S. 11:292), although such exception applies to the benefits. These
provisions apply to judges and court officers; members of the Teachers' Optional Retirement
Plan; Orleans Parish school employees; LSU Retirement System members; employees of the
city of Alexandria and of the city of Bogalusa; firefighters in the city of Alexandria, the
consolidated fire districts of Bastrop, the city of Bossier City, the city of Houma, the city of
Lake Charles, the city of Monroe, the city of New Orleans, Fire Protection District Number
One for the parish of Ouachita, the city of Shreveport, and the city of West Monroe; police
officers in any municipality having a population between 7,500 and 250,000 and in the city
of Lafayette; and employees of the New Orleans Sewerage and Water Board.
Proposed law retains present law and adds specific reference to the applicable exception for
child support contained in present law.
Proposed law provides that the pension or retirement benefit of an elected official or former
elected official payable from any public retirement or pension system, plan, or fund may be
subject to seizure or garnishment for payment of any restitution or fine imposed upon
conviction of or a plea of guilty or nolo contendere to a felony associated with the elected
official's service for which such retirement benefit was earned or accrued.
Proposed law specifies that, notwithstanding any provision of law to the contrary, a
garnishment authorized pursuant to proposed law may be continuing in nature as necessary
to pay the court-ordered restitution or fine in full.
Effective July 1, 2010.
